Renault Pin Extractor 2 is a specialized software tool primarily used by automotive technicians to calculate security PIN codes (APV) and "incodes" for Renault and Dacia vehicles. These codes are essential for tasks such as programming new keys, matching immobilizer units (UCH), or performing offline ECU reprogramming. Key Capabilities and Use Cases

PIN Calculation: It can derive the 4-digit or 12-to-14-character security PIN required for key learning by using the vehicle's ISK code or Outcode.

Immobilizer Support: The tool supports various immobilizer and UCH types, including Siemens 9366, Sagem 9366, Johnson Controls 95080, and UCH 95160.

Clip Integration: It is often used alongside the Renault CAN Clip diagnostic tool to calculate the "Incode" requested by the official software during a "card learning" procedure. Technical Context & Common Issues

ISK Code Retrieval: To use the extractor, you often first need to find the "RESERVE" command in the vehicle's diagnostic menu (often using code 5938) to display the ISK code.

Accuracy Limitations: Users have reported that Version 2 may calculate incorrectly for certain newer models, such as the Megane 2 or Scenic 2, though it remains reliable for calculating directly from an EEPROM dump.

Renault Pin Extractor 2: A Professional Guide to Immobilizer Key Coding

When dealing with modern vehicle security, the Renault Pin Extractor 2 has established itself as a critical piece of software for locksmiths and automotive technicians. This tool is primarily used to interact with the immobilizer systems of Renault and Dacia vehicles, allowing users to retrieve the necessary security codes to program new keys or cards. What is Renault Pin Extractor 2?

Renault Pin Extractor 2 is a specialized utility designed to calculate security codes—specifically the PIN, VIN, and ISK codes—by analyzing the "dump" (data file) from a vehicle's immobilizer (Immo) unit. It is often used in conjunction with diagnostic hardware like the Renault CAN Clip to facilitate offline reprogramming and key pairing. Core Functions and Features

The software provides several advanced capabilities for managing vehicle security:

PIN Calculation: Extracts the 4 or 8-digit PIN required for key registration.

ISK to PIN Conversion: Recalculates the PIN code using the ISK (Immobilizer Search Key).

Virginizing Immo Blocks: Clears an immobilizer unit's data so it can be re-bound to a different vehicle (Virgin).

Incode-Outcode Calculator: Generates the matching Incode needed for certain diagnostic operations.

Key Tag Calculation: Determines the PIN code directly from the physical tag found on a key. Compatibility List

Renault Pin Extractor 2 supports a wide range of electronic control units (ECUs) and Immobilizer units (UCH) found in Renault and Dacia models: Siemens 9366: Commonly found in older Renault models.

Sagem 9366: Used in the Clio 2, Kangoo, Master, and Traffic, as well as the Opel Vivaro and Movano.

Johnson Controls 95080/95160: Found in Clio 3, Modus, and post-2007 Kangoo/Master models.

Continental 95040: Utilized in newer models like the Logan, Duster, and Sandero (2010+). MC68HC912DG128: Found in Laguna 2 and Velsatis. Important Safety and Download Information

Renault Pin Extractor 2 is a specialized diagnostic software tool used primarily by automotive technicians and locksmiths to retrieve immobilizer security PIN codes for Renault and Dacia vehicles. These PINs are necessary for critical tasks such as programming new keys, replacing control units (UCH), and performing advanced diagnostics. Key Software Features

The tool provides multiple methods for PIN retrieval depending on the data available from the vehicle: Extracting PIN from Dump

: Calculates the PIN by reading the "dump" file from various immobilizer units (ImmoBox). Calculating PIN by ISK : Uses the Immobilizer Secret Key (ISK)

code, which can often be retrieved from the vehicle using diagnostic tools like Renault CAN Clip. Calculating PIN by Tag

: Generates codes directly from the key tag for specific immobilizer types. Incode/Outcode Calculation : Supports "Incode" generation for the Renault CAN Clip diagnostic interface during key learning procedures. Reprog Code Generation

: Capable of calculating codes for offline reprogramming of vehicle modules. Supported Immobilizer & Chip Types

The software is compatible with a wide range of Renault/Dacia electronic modules and EEPROM chips, including: : 9346, 9366 (Clio 2, Kangoo, Master, Traffic) Johnson Controls : 95080, 9366 (Logan, Duster, Sandero 2007–2010+) : 95160 (Laguna 2 Ph2, Espace IV) Motorola MCUs : MC68HC912DG128, MC9S12DG256 (Megane 2, Scenic 2) Usage and Availability
